现代编译原理

现代编译原理 pdf epub mobi txt 电子书 下载 2025

Andrew W. Appel

美国普林斯顿大学计算机科学系教授,第26届ACM SIGPLAN-SIGACT程序设计原理年会大会执行主席,1998~1999年在贝尔实验室做研究工作。主要研究方向是计算机安全、编译器设计、程序设计语言等。

Maia Ginsburg

美国普林斯顿大学计算机科学系讲师。

出版者:人民邮电出版社
作者:[美]Andrew W.Appel
出品人:图灵教育
页数:400
译者:赵克佳
出版时间:2018-4
价格:89.00元
装帧:平装
isbn号码:9787115476883
丛书系列:图灵计算机科学丛书
图书标签:
  • 编译原理 
  • 计算机科学 
  • 计算机 
  • Compiler 
  • 虎书 
  • 编程 
  • 编译 
  • 经典 
  •  
想要找书就要到 图书目录大全
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

本书全面讲述了现代编译器的各个组成部分,包括词法分析、语法分析、抽象语法、语义检查、中间代码表示、指令选择、数据流分析、寄存器分配以及运行时系统等。全书分成两部分,第一部分是编译的基础知识,适用于第一门编译原理课程(一个学期);第二部分是高级主题,包括面向对象语言和函数语言、垃圾收集、循环优化、存储结构优化等,适合于后续课程或研究生教学。

具体描述

读后感

评分

本书和龙书都全篇阅读完过,与龙书相比相差太远,这是一本编译方面的入门书,但你最好别信,你需要懂编译方面的原理,因为这本书偏重实践,很多地方原理不讲或者简单地一笔带过,点到即止,没看过龙书,你甚至不知道它在讲什么。  

评分

本书和龙书都全篇阅读完过,与龙书相比相差太远,这是一本编译方面的入门书,但你最好别信,你需要懂编译方面的原理,因为这本书偏重实践,很多地方原理不讲或者简单地一笔带过,点到即止,没看过龙书,你甚至不知道它在讲什么。  

评分

翻了这么多本书,这是我看过的唯一一本讲具体怎么构建一个编译器的书。同时这本书所构建的编译器就像作者说的那样,简单但是并不平庸,拥有很多挺先进的特性。也能算是一个优化编译器。 但是要跟着这本书做下来还是有一定难度的,需要扎实的C语言功底。  

评分

实在是和实际工作差的远了点,而且理论的东西太多。如果不是真的想研究编译器的话,读读知道个大概也就行了。 开始的编译树等知识还能凑和看懂,进入路径优化和寄存器分配就完全是在云里雾里的感觉。优化部分,《深入理解计算机》里讲得更实用。 书里最有意思的应该是分别把T...  

评分

正在读,刚跟着它的实践练习做到第四章。这本书确实讲的简略,重在实践。前端部分个人觉得《编译原理与实践》讲的最通俗易懂,可以先熟悉那部分再看这本书估计就能跟着练习走了。 p.s. 书中的代码只是个示范,可能要做些改动才能运行  

用户评价

评分

- 编译原理(龙书)/现代编译原理(虎书): 编译原理是真的难

评分

能把计算机类书籍讲的不在天上在地上,大家都知道,这是一件相当难的事情,这本书做到了。

评分

适合新手,可以边读边实现

评分

翻译是败笔 "它有嵌套的作用域和在堆中分配储存空间的记录,虽简单却并不平凡" 是不是应该是"它支持"呢?而且原文就用的with,真不知道怎么翻译的

评分

翻译是败笔 "它有嵌套的作用域和在堆中分配储存空间的记录,虽简单却并不平凡" 是不是应该是"它支持"呢?而且原文就用的with,真不知道怎么翻译的

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2025 book.wenda123.org All Rights Reserved. 图书目录大全 版权所有